Drake's was founded in 1977 in East London by Michael Drake as a small atelier producing handmade silk scarves and ties for the London tailoring trade. For three decades the brand operated quietly as a wholesale supplier to Savile Row tailors and high-end menswear shops; the breakthrough came in 2010 when Michael Hill (then a long-time Drake's customer) acquired the business and pivoted it toward direct-to-consumer. The Drake's vocabulary expanded under Hill's direction into a full menswear offering: hand-rolled silk ties (still produced in the Haberdasher Street workshop in Shoreditch), button-down oxford shirts (the brand's flagship category), tweed jackets, Madras shirting, knitwear, and the increasingly ambitious 'Games' seasonal collections that combine British craft references with hand-painted prints and travel-inspired colour stories. The brand became one of the leading voices in the international 'Ivy revival' of the 2010s. Drake's operates flagships in London (the Clifford Street store, the Savile Row store, and the East End atelier on Haberdasher Street), New York (Crosby Street), and Tokyo (Aoyama). The brand remains independent and is held by Hill and his partners. Production is overwhelmingly British, with ties and scarves made in London, shirts in Somerset, and knitwear in Scotland. Timeline4

  1. 1977

    Drake's founded

    Michael Drake, Jeremy Hull and Isabel Dickson founded Drake's in London, focused on scarves and ties.

  2. 2010

    Michael Hill leads expansion

    Michael Hill became creative director and expanded the brand into full menswear collections.

  3. 2014

    Clifford Street store opens

    Drake's opened its first store at 3 Clifford Street, near Savile Row in London.

  4. 2019

    New York shop opens

    Drake's opened its New York store on Crosby Street in SoHo.
